Grand Rapids-Kentwood vs Idaho Falls

Fair Market Rent Comparison — HUD 2025 Data

Quick Answer

Idaho Falls is 5% cheaper for renters. A 2-bedroom rents for $897/mo vs $945/mo in Grand Rapids-Kentwood — saving $576/year.

Rent by Unit Size

Unit SizeGrand Rapids-KentwoodIdaho FallsDifference
Studio$583$583$0
1 Bedroom$741$710$31
2 Bedrooms$945$897$48
3 Bedrooms$1,145$1,089$56
4 Bedrooms$1,345$1,288$57
Median Income$58,686$42,238$16,448
